Anambra Assembly passes N74.5bn budget for 2008
At long last, the Anambra State Appropriation Bill 2008 was yesterday passed into law by the state House of Assembly. The N84.2 billion proposed bill by Governor Peter Obi was, however, reduced to N74.5 billion before it was passed by the lawmakers.
KING OF WOMEN
The instinct to survive appears to be breaking the barrier of gender monopoly in some vocations. The females may have started it with the maxim: “What a man can do, a woman can do even better.” So, when Onyema Nwachukwu after leaving secondary school in Kano could not find a job, he decided to earn a living from nail fixing and polishing, a predominantly female vocation. After all, what a woman can do, a man can also do better.
